  2. Here are some examples of how to use “repel” in a sentence123:
    • A fabric that repels water.
    • Their superior forces repelled the invasion.
    • Two positive electrical charges repel each other.
    • Magnets can both repel and attract one another.
    • Hopefully the air freshener will repel the odor of the deceased rodent.
    • Because the dinner is being served outside, we’ll use special candles to repel insects from the table.
    • The king's men used arrows to repel invaders away from the castle.
    • The strong smell of the repellent spray will repel mosquitoes.
    • The magnet’s north pole repels other north poles.
    • The force of the water repelled the boat from the shore.

    What does repel mean?Repel is a verb that commonly refers to the action of driving away or pushing back something or someone. It is derived from the Latin word “repellere,” which means “to drive back.” The term “repel” can be used in various contexts, and its meaning may vary depending on the specific situation in which it is used.
